Seventh Circuit Holds That 2009 CMS Letter Triggered Public Disclosure Bar for Pre- and Post-Letter Conduct
The Seventh Circuit affirmed the dismissal of an FCA suit alleging that a psychiatric hospital submitted claims to Medicaid despite maintaining a higher patient census than the hospital was licensed to maintain, providing some important clarification on the scope of the public disclosure bar.
